Harbour Capital Advisors LLC Takes $303,000 Position in Waystar Holding Corp. $WAY

Harbour Capital Advisors LLC purchased a new position in shares of Waystar Holding Corp. (NASDAQ:WAY - Free Report) in the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or purchased 7,830 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$303,000.

Waystar (NASDAQ:WAY -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, July 30th. The company reported $0.36 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.33 by $0.03. The business had revenue of $270.65 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$255.26 million. Waystar had a return on equity of 5.65% and a net margin of 8.50%.The company's revenue for the quarter was up 15.4%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$0.04 earnings per share. Waystar has set its FY 2025 guidance at 1.360-1.400 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ts anticipate that Waystar Holding Corp. will post 0.39 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Waystar Profile

(Free Report)

Waystar Holding Corp. is a software company which provide healthcare payments. Waystar Holding Corp. is based in LEHI, Utah.
